Buying Guide for the Best Earl Gray Teas

Choosing the right Earl Grey tea can be a delightful journey, as this classic tea blend offers a variety of flavors and aromas. Earl Grey tea is traditionally a black tea flavored with bergamot oil, but there are many variations available. To find the best fit for you, consider the following key specifications and how they align with your preferences.
Tea BaseThe tea base refers to the type of tea leaves used in the blend. Common bases include black tea, green tea, and oolong tea. Black tea is the traditional choice and offers a robust flavor, while green tea provides a lighter, more delicate taste. Oolong tea falls somewhere in between, with a smooth and complex flavor profile. Your choice should depend on your preference for tea strength and flavor complexity.
Bergamot IntensityBergamot is the citrus fruit that gives Earl Grey its distinctive aroma and flavor. The intensity of bergamot can vary from subtle to strong. If you prefer a mild citrus note, look for teas with a lighter bergamot presence. For a more pronounced citrus flavor, choose blends with a higher bergamot intensity. Your preference for citrus flavors will guide you in selecting the right intensity.
Additional IngredientsSome Earl Grey teas include additional ingredients such as lavender, vanilla, or other spices to enhance the flavor profile. These variations can add unique twists to the traditional taste. If you enjoy floral or sweet notes, consider trying blends with these added ingredients. Your taste preferences for complexity and additional flavors will help you decide which blend to choose.
Leaf GradeThe leaf grade indicates the quality and size of the tea leaves. Whole leaf teas are generally considered higher quality and offer a fuller flavor, while broken leaf or fannings may brew faster but can be less flavorful. If you value a rich and nuanced tea experience, opt for whole leaf varieties. For quicker brewing and convenience, broken leaf options might be more suitable.
Organic CertificationOrganic certification means the tea is grown without synthetic pesticides or fertilizers. Organic teas can be a healthier choice and are often preferred by those who are environmentally conscious. If you prioritize health and sustainability, look for teas with organic certification.
PackagingEarl Grey tea can come in various packaging forms, such as loose leaf, tea bags, or sachets. Loose leaf tea often provides a higher quality and more customizable brewing experience, while tea bags and sachets offer convenience and ease of use. Your lifestyle and preference for convenience versus quality will help you decide the best packaging for you.
